The price of copper rebounded slightly today after falling to a 5. 5 year low yesterday in part after the World Bank Revised down its Global Growth forecast. Copper is seen as a key barometer for economic performance. Its up 1. 6 today but still down over 30 13 over the last 30 days. Were joined now by andrew head of metals and mining and still with us is richard, head of Global Strategies at t. D. Securities. Andrew. Lets start with you. Thank you for joining us this morning. Coppers belated sharp sell off year to date particularly yesterday, is it catching up with the general commodities sell off we saw last year particularly in oil . Thats what the market is trying to get it to do. Theres a narrative in the market at the moment that were trying to get all commodities to do the same thing all at once. Copper is sitting out there. Its a very high profile, liquid, high beater commodity. People do try to lump them together. The hard thing is commodities do tend to move together for lots of reasons. You can get a Dollar Strength depression. You can get implications of oil coming through and of course you get a lot of redemptions and a lot of shorting of it as an asset class. The market is trying to mark it into a demand issue. There must be a big physical problem in the copper market. The problem is actually theres not a lot of data that says that. Industrial Metal Industries fell in the Fourth Quarter and most markets are still doing what we all expect them to do in any case. Everybody is trying to lump it into a demand issue. Given the recent drop in the price of copper do you think some countries will take advantage and buy on the dip . One example is china which saw a record oil import number earlier this week taking advantage of a decline in oil prices. The big lesson in 2009 is that the chinese are able to buy and store significant amount of cops. Copper is different to oil is that you dont have the storage constraints. China is about 45 of demand they net buy about 9 million in copper a year. Theyre investing in other areas. I guess you can store oil on sea which as copper you cant do the same. But you can store it in warehouse and its a high value dense material. So you can have large quantities of it. So therefore i think if youre going to see a lot of potential buying out there. Its a real bear trap at the moment. I get that people are trying to explain the oil commodities. Doesnt explain why yesterday we saw 7 . All of a sudden a massive sell off. Whats the reason for that move particularly yesterday . The thing thats changed a lot of people trying to point to inventory moves. When you look at producers theyre not saying they have an immediate demand issue. What youre seeing is a Significant Growth in short interest. I think copper has been sitting out there as a very visible commodity to go short on in terms of growth issues and in terms of the commodity narrative. Its mostly speculative shorting taking it down to this level. And in the shortterm in terms of trying to workout when that supply demand balance can move up again does Chinese New Year have a big effect on chinese copper. Id love to see a big effect and i tried to look at it over several years. You get a slight interruption in demand but tends to not necessarily see a huge amount of price action, seasonality over the past year or two. I think what youre seeing at the moment is consensus. A supply driven surplus. The narrative of that is coming in. Most people are in the process of gutting their supply surpluses this year because of a lot of delays to mine projects and were seeing people bring their fundamental things back toward a balanced market. So youre actually seeing a strange shift at the moment. People are getting more bullish fundamentally but the markets selling off. Thank you for joining us this morning. They also surprised the market by cutting its deposit rate. For more reaction were joined by jane foley. Some of the words used to describe this move have been dumbfounded, surprised, shocked. If they were deciding to abandon their three year standing currency flaw against the euro surely they would have done it in a more managed fashion. The moves in the markets highlight the surprise with this decision. You might think so. If they hinted at doing it then the market would have just pushed the franc down anyway or the value down anyway. It was a very difficult decision to manage but we must look to see whether or not the writing was on the wall and those at a tried to defend this flaw was becoming more difficult and the reason was the Balance Sheet. We look at the snbs Balance Sheet and what we see in currency terms is its becoming increasingly top heavy with the euros and over the last few weeks and months and look to see what the ecb have been doing, well draghi has been successful in pushing down the value of the euro and as the value of the jurors regoes down theres more definite to be done to protect that 120 flaw. So at the ecb is very aggressive or draghis very aggressive language in recent weeks has been making the the job more difficult for the snb. You get on top of that and put on extra safe haven demand. Weve seen that move the yen this week. So maintaining that law is difficult for the snb to do given the unbalanced look at their Balance Sheet. Its increasingly difficult for them to maintain the flaw. The timing of this decision. Do you think that means that the snb is very confident the ecb is about to make it harder for them to maintain that flaw . Thats possibly the case. Yesterday we had aggressive language too. All of these European Central banks are playing second fiddle. Theyre trying to defend themselves in the wake of this weakening euro. Now they have the benefit of seeing the Exchange Rate relatively weak right now. Many Central Banks have Interest Rates on the floor and they have been looking at the currency as hoping the currency can stay weak but we have seen over the past three years that this experiment that the snb have been using with this flaw has been worked either. So the very aggressive language from the ecb certainly making policy much more difficult for some of these other Central Banks in europe. And of course you are a strategist, a currency strategist. How does this surprise move from this Swiss National bank change your consensus on the swiss franc Going Forward. We certainly we have a stronger swiss franc in our sights. What the snb have said one of the things at a made it possible is weve had the stronger dollar and the Dollar Strengthening against the swiss franc and if we have a repricing of fed Interest Rate hike expectations that trend may flatten down too but for now the swiss authorities have to probably just put one the fact that the swiss franc is going to be stronger for now until theres signs that the ecb is winning at their deflationary battle. Perhaps more clarity on january 22nd. Thank you for your time and market perspective. We have been seeing the swiss equity market drop sharply in todays trade. Down 7. 7 .
